
\n";<br> }<br> return 0;<br>} 查找最后一次出现的位置(rfind) 如果想查找子字符串最后一次出现的位置,可以使用 rfind()。 但是,如果我们尝试使用参数化查询来动态指定排序的列:rows, err := db.Query("S...

在C#中使用Dapper时,动态参数是通过 匿名对象 或 IDynamicParameters 接口实现的。 这个函数是处理此类需求的最佳选择,因为它更加简洁、高效且易于理解。 不复杂但容易忽略细节。 Azure Key Vault:提供密钥、证书和机密的统一管理。 然后,合并结果与advertis...

播记 播客shownotes生成器 | 为播客创作者而生 43 查看详情 多客户端接收与响应设计 每个客户端可监听固定端口接收广播,同时也能主动向服务端回传信息,形成双向通信。 如果需要修改链表的结构,必须直接修改 self.head 或者链表中节点的 next 指针。 本文旨在解决FCC国家宽带地...

立即学习“go语言免费学习笔记(深入)”; 通过中间件统一处理鉴权 在Gin、Echo等Web框架中,可以编写中间件拦截所有请求,集中处理鉴权逻辑。 请注意您的API使用量,并根据需要申请更高的配额。 例如,当你通过template.New("myTemplate")创建模板时,Name()将返回"...

Web服务器配置:在使用Nginx + PHP-FPM时,确保Nginx的fastcgi_param配置正确地将所有请求头部传递给PHP-FPM。 立即学习“go语言免费学习笔记(深入)”; 根本原因在于,任何程序最终都需要在计算机上执行,而计算机只能理解机器码。 立即学习“PHP免费学习笔记(深入...

强大的语音识别、AR翻译功能。 适合读远多于写的场景;若写操作频繁,RWMutex 可能不如普通 Mutex 高效。 智谱清言 - 免费全能的AI助手 智谱清言 - 免费全能的AI助手 2 查看详情 // Uint64LEFromT 将T结构体的内容转换为一个uint64,假设为小端序。 设定最大重...

基本上就这些。 如果发生错误,应立即处理并返回,避免对一个无效的文件句柄进行操作。 总结 在 Laravel 中实现路由的“或”逻辑多重认证,核心在于将每种认证方式配置为独立的认证守卫,然后利用 auth 中间件的守卫列表功能。 统一接口: 尽管底层类型不同,但通过类型别名,我们在上层代码中始终使用...

通过一个实际的API数据示例,文章演示了如何将列表中的每个子字典的token和tsym字段转换为新字典的键和值,从而实现数据的精准筛选与重组,提升数据处理的简洁性和效率。 $(document).ready(function() { ... });:这是一个jQuery函数,它确保其中的代码只在整个...

这个设置主要用于OAuth授权流程中的回调URL(Callback URL)或重定向URI的验证。 通过在您的操作系统上安装相应的libleveldb-dev(或其等效包),可以确保提供所有必要的依赖项和链接信息,从而使Levigo能够顺利编译。 下面介绍如何在常见的PHP框架中集成这两类图表库。 ...

拷贝构造函数的基本定义语法 拷贝构造函数的函数名与类名相同,参数是该类类型的常量引用,通常形式如下: MyClass(const MyClass& other); 注意:参数必须使用引用,否则会引发无限递归(因为传值会再次调用拷贝构造函数)。 name属性对于表单提交至关重要,它定义了字段的...